Terminal strip drawing

Menu: Project > Configurations > Terminal strip drawing...

Dockable panel > Contextual menu of Project: Configurations > Terminal strip drawing...

 

On launching the command, the terminal strip drawing configuration manager is automatically displayed. This lists all the different configurations available.

 

The left side of the dialog box displays the available configurations within the application. The right side displays a list of configurations available in the current project.

 

New: Creates a new configuration file. A dialog box opens asking you to select the type of configuration to create, in IEC standard or DIN standard.

Delete: Deletes the selected configuration file.

Properties: Edits the selected configuration file.

Duplicate: Copies a configuration file. A message asks you if you would like to open the file to modify it.

Add to project / to application: Adds configurations available at application level to your project and, in the same way, to make a configuration you have created for your project available at application level.

Archive: Creates a configuration archive file. This feature is used to exchange configuration files.

Unarchive: Recovers a configuration file that was initially archived.

 

Set as default configuration: Defines the selected configuration file as the file to be used by default. This file is that selected in the General tab of the project configuration.

 

Rename: Renames the selected configuration file. A dialog box opens asking you to define the new name of the file.
